What is a 45-Foot Container?
A 45-foot container is a shipping container designed for carrying items over cross countries. Generally made from steel, these containers are built to stand up to extreme environmental conditions while offering a safe and spacious environment for cargo. The increase in popularity of this size can be credited to its adequate interior area compared to the more conventional 20-foot and 40-foot containers.
Key SpecificationsSpecificationDetermined ValueExternal Length13.7 meters (45 ft)External Width2.44 meters (8 ft)External Height2.59 meters (8.6 ft)Internal Length13.5 meters (44.5 ft)Internal Width2.35 meters (7.7 ft)Internal Height2.39 meters (7.9 ft)Maximum PayloadAs much as 30,480 kg (67,200 lbs)Volume Capacity76.4 cubic meters (2,703 cubic feet)
The dimensions of 45-foot containers can vary a little based on the producer, however these specifications usually stay constant throughout basic designs.

Regardless of their many advantages, it's vital to consider prospective constraints when using or renting 45-foot containers:
1. Minimal Availability in Some Regions
While 45 Foot Container Dimensions-foot containers are widely used worldwide, they may not be as readily available in certain locations compared to standard sizes like 20 or 40 feet.
2. Managing Challenges
The larger size may present logistical challenges in regards to dealing with and maneuverability. It's necessary for businesses to make sure that their centers and transport methods are geared up to manage these containers successfully.
3. Weight Restrictions
Depending on the port and specific guidelines, weight limits might affect how efficiently a 45-foot container can be filled, particularly for much heavier items.

Just how much Does a 45-Foot Container Weigh?
A standard empty 45-foot container typically has a weight of around 3,900 kg (8,598 pounds).
2. What Can You Fit in a 45-Foot Container?
You can fit around 76.4 cubic meters of cargo, which could include anything from machinery to pallets of products.
3. How Much Does it Cost to Rent a 45-Foot Container?
Rental expenses differ considerably based upon place, period, and the kind of container required, however typically vary from ₤ 100 to ₤ 300 monthly.
4. Can You Ship a 45-Foot Container by Air?
No, 45-foot containers are created for maritime shipping and are not ideal for air transportation due to their size and weight.
